``` 冷钱包的定义与重要性 在数字货币日益普及的今天,保护好自己的加密资产显得尤为重要。冷钱包是一种离线存储...
多重签名(Multi-Signature)是一种安全协议,允许多个用户共同控制一个数字钱包或账户。它的基本原理是在进行交易时,需要多个密钥的签名才能完成交易,这与传统单一签名的方式大相径庭。多重签名在区块链技术中扮演着十分重要的角色,为数字货币的安全性提供了保障。
随着区块链技术的快速发展,数字货币的使用也逐渐普及。然而,数字货币的安全性问题却渐渐成为了用户关注的焦点。这时,多重签名技术便应运而生。通过将多个签名结合起来,有效提升了账户资金的安全性,避免了单点失败的风险。
多重签名的工作原理相对简单:在创建一个多重签名地址时,用户可以设置需要多少个签名才能完成交易。这些签名来自于不同的私钥,通常是由不同的持有者提供。例如,一个 2-of-3 的多重签名地址意味着,地址下有三个持有者的私钥,但只需要其中两个签名就可以发起交易。
这种机制既能够保障资金的安全性,又能灵活应对不同场景下的需求。例如,在企业环境中,可以要求高级管理人员共同签名才能完成资金的转账,提高了内部控制的严谨性。
多重签名的最主要作用是提高交易的安全性。利用多重签名技术,即使一个私钥被黑客窃取,也无法单独发起交易,因为还需要其他私钥的签名。这一机制显著降低了黑客攻击的成功率,为用户提供了额外的安全层。
在企业中,资金管理需要严谨的内部控制。多重签名能够确保在高风险交易的情况下,需要多个关键人员的授权才能完成,从而降低了单一员工滥用权限的风险。此外,某些行业也需要符合监管机构的合规要求,使用多重签名可以帮助企业更好地满足这些要求。
多重签名的机制使得所有参与者的签名都被记录在区块链上,每笔交易都可以追溯到参与的每个签名者。这种透明度提高了问责制,所有签名者都对交易的合法性负责,减少了内部舞弊的可能性。
在某些情况下,用户可能遗失了自己的私钥。通过多重签名机制,如果用户设置的签名被多个持有者所控制,则在恢复账户时可以获得更多的灵活性。例如,如果有三个私钥,用户只需保留其中之一,而其他两个签名者可以协助完成交易,以确保账户的运作不受影响。
多重签名技术在多个领域得到了广泛的应用,以下列举几个具体的实例。
在数字货币交易平台中,多重签名被用于保护用户资产。许多交易所都采用这一技术,确保交易所的冷钱包存储资产更加安全。即使黑客攻击了交易所的另一个部分,也无法简单地提取资金。
一些企业在进行大额资金转账时,通常会要求多个高级管理人员共同参与,例如财务总监、CEO等都需签名确认。这种模式不仅增强了安全性,也确保了资金使用的合理性与合规性。
智能合约中也常常集成多重签名技术,用于确保所有相关方的同意,只有在满足特定条件时,合同才能执行。这种做法契合了区块链去中心化信任的理念,提高了合约执行的安全性。
一些投资基金采用多重签名来控制资金流动,通常需要多个投资经理的签名才能进行投资决策或赎回请求。这种机制不仅可以避免单个人的错误决策,还可以增强投资策略的稳定性。
多重签名这种技术虽然在许多情况下都极为有效,但并不适合所有类型的数字钱包。例如,对于一些小额交易或者个人用户使用情况,可能会觉得多重签名带来的复杂性和不便不符合需求。在这种情况下,普通的单一签名钱包可能更加适合。
另外,在涉及到高频交易的场景中,多重签名的延迟可能会影响交易的时效性。因此,用户在选择钱包及其签名方式时,应根据自己的具体需求与环境作出判断。对于普通用户来说,一个简单易用的单一签名钱包要比复杂的多重签名钱包更加便捷。
设置多重签名通常需要通过支持此功能的钱包软件进行操作。一般来说,用户需要在创建钱包时选择多重签名的选项,并指定需要几个人的签名才能批准交易。以比特币为例,用户通常会看到类似“2-of-3”的选项,表示3个密钥中需2个签名才能进行交易。
不同数字钱包软件的界面与接口会有所不同,但它们大都提供了详尽的设置指南和步骤。用户在进行设置时,需要遵循说明,以确保每个签名者正确地生成和保存自己的私钥,确保其安全性。
丢失多重签名中的某个私钥并不一定导致账户的永久丢失。具体情况取决于实现多重签名的方式。如果设置为3个密钥中的2个签名,那么即使有一个私钥丢失,用户仍可以通过剩下的两个私钥完成交易。
然而,如果丢失的私钥正好是必需的签名者之一,用户将面对失去访问其资产的风险。因此,用户在设置多重签名时应谨慎考虑,确保每个密钥的持有者都能安全地保管其私钥,并制定好恢复方案。
多重签名会增加每笔交易需要的时间和步骤,因为每次交易都需要多个参与者的签名。用户必须确保所有签名者都及时响应请求,这样才能使交易迅速完成。如果某个签名者不在给定时间内响应,交易可能会延迟。
因此,在跨国或全球团队的情况下,多重签名的相关操作可能会面临更多挑战。在这种情况下,企业可以考虑设置高效的沟通和响应机制,以提高交易效率。例如,可以利用协作软件或专门的通知系统减少延误的时间。
多重签名作为一种提升数字资产安全性的技术手段,正在被越来越多的用户和企业采用。通过要求多个用户的签名,多重签名有效降低了单点故障的风险,提高了安全性与透明度,同时也方便了监管与合规管理。虽然多重签名并不适合所有场景,但在大多数需要对资金进行严格控制的情况下,它的作用不可小觑。对于未来,随着区块链技术的发展和普及,多重签名的应用将会更加广泛。